The CY8C22345-24PVXA is a part of the PSOC®1 CY8C22xxx series of microcontrollers from Infineon Technologies. It features an M8C core processor with a speed of 24MHz, making it suitable for various embedded applications. The microcontroller has 24 I/O pins and a program memory size of 16KB (16K x 8) which is stored in FLASH memory type. It also has 1K x 8 RAM size for data storage. The CY8C22345-24PVXA supports connectivity through I2C, IrDA, SPI, and UART/USART interfaces. It comes in a surface mount package with 28-SSOP (0.209", 5.30mm Width) dimensions. The operating temperature range for this microcontroller is -40°C to 85°C. It has a voltage supply range of 3V to 5.25V. With its various peripherals like LVD, POR, PWM, and WDT, this microcontroller provides flexibility and versatility for designing embedded systems. Please note that this product is currently in the last time buy status.